Who was the ugliest god

While Greek mythology evokes images of breathtaking beauty, there are tales of gods and goddesses who may not conform to conventional standards of attractiveness. Among them, the god Hephaestus is often described as physically unattractive. However, it’s important to note that beauty and divinity in Greek mythology go beyond physical appearance, encompassing various qualities and powers.

What flowers does Persephone like

As the goddess of spring, Persephone adores and holds a deep connection to various flowers. While specific varieties may differ across interpretations, flowers such as narcissus, daffodils, poppies, and lilies are often associated with her. These blooms symbolize fertility, rebirth, and the awakening of nature after the cold grasp of winter.
